Health and Retirement Study
Definición
- The Health and Retirement Study (HRS), founded in 1990, is an ongoing panel (cohort) population study of older Americans supported by the U.S. National Institute on Aging (NIA) with additional support from other U.S. federal agencies. Design details, documentation, questionnaires, and the historical and scientific evolution of the HRS can be found on the HRS website ().
